Description
A collapsible ultra-lightweight stool designed for maximum portability.
The stool's legs screw securely into the base of the stool for use and eyelets are provided on the underside for stowage using a tied piece of bungee cord - The design is intended to use 4mm cord, the standard size needs approx 45-50cm of cord, the larger size needs around 65-70cm, tied as shown below:

A carry eyelet is also provided to attach to bag straps or similar via a short rope loop or a carabiner - I find a printed carabiner works really well for this.
The feet are printed in TPU, for use on flat ground/floors these aren't strictly necessary but help on uneven surfaces. The feet can simply be pushed onto the ends of the legs and friction will hold them in place securely, alternatively a small blob of glue will fix them permanently.
The model is available in 2 sizes, with 3 different print profiles
Original lightweight - Designed for minimum weight measuring 21cm across and 26cm tall this is ideal as a footstool or a stool for a child. Weighs only 376g and tested to support over 50kg.
Original reinforced - Same dimensions as the lightweight model but with some reinforcement throughout, provides additional load bearing and strength for sideways shear movement. 436g, tested to support 75kg comfortably.
NOTE: The reinforcement around the screw threads on the legs of this profile makes this an especially challenging print on a bed slinger such as the A1, as the legs are slightly top-heavy. Please ensure your bed is clean and running at the correct temperature for optimal adhesion, otherwise the print is liable to fall over 80-90% through.
Larger reinforced - A full adult-sized stool with a generous 30cm width and 33cm height, the model readily supports 150kg evenly-distributed but requires a larger-sized printer such as an H2D to print, and weighs 937g.
Tested weights are with static loads and printed using Bambu Basic PLA - I would recommend avoiding filaments with weaker layer adhesion, such as Matte PLA.
